Terms to Know for a Smoother Sydney Office Strip Out

Phased Strip Out

A phased strip out is the staged removal of fixtures, fittings and finishes so parts of the office can remain operational while work is underway. It allows demolition to happen in manageable sections rather than shutting the entire workplace at once.


Site Isolation

Site isolation refers to separating the work area from the rest of the building to control access, dust and noise. It may involve barriers, signage and temporary protections around occupied spaces.


Soft Strip

A soft strip is the careful removal of non-structural elements such as carpet, ceiling tiles, partitions, joinery, doors and old fittings. It prepares the space for refurbishment without affecting the building’s main structure.


Waste Management

Waste management is the organised collection, sorting and disposal of debris created during demolition and strip out works. It includes removing rubbish promptly and ensuring materials are handled responsibly.


Occupational Health and Safety

Occupational health and safety covers the procedures and controls used to protect workers and building occupants during construction activity. This includes managing hazards, using protective equipment and following safe work methods.


Program Sequencing

Program sequencing is the planned order in which tasks are completed to keep a project moving efficiently. It helps coordinate demolition, strip out, removals and follow-on works so trades are not waiting around.



Structural Protection

Structural protection means taking care not to damage load-bearing elements, services or parts of the building that must remain in place. It often involves careful demolition methods and close attention to what can and cannot be removed.

  • Can You Complete Strip Out Works Outside Normal Business Hours?

    Yes, where required, we can organise works to suit your operating hours and reduce disruption to staff and visitors.


     This is especially useful for busy offices that cannot afford major interruptions during the workday. By carrying out demolition and removal tasks after hours or over weekends, we help you keep business as usual for longer.

  • Will a Strip Out Affect the Rest of the Building?

    We take great care to minimise impact on surrounding tenancies, shared areas and building operations. Before works begin, we assess access routes, noise considerations and the areas that need protection so the strip out is contained and well managed. 


    For example, if your office sits within a larger commercial building, we can plan the work to avoid unnecessary disruption to neighbouring tenants and common spaces.
